I'd like to hear your thoughts on this, since it's definitely not like what I normally post. EDIT: After "revealing" this to =DalaiHarma what I went through to take this shot, I'll share it with you. Things I had to keep in mind, and do in order for this shot to work. 1. I had to try and get the camera's macro mode to focus on the magnifying glass. 2. I had to hold the incredibly heavy magnifying glass with very shaky hands. 3. I had to find an angle to try and keep the reflection of the camera/tripod and lightbulb out of the shot. 4. The lightbulb was hanging above my head, just out of frame, 100 watts, and I felt like my scalp was on fire. 5. I had to keep my eye on the reflection of the LCD in the mirror. 6. I had 2 seconds to get everything ready in frame after pressing the button/timer on my camera. 7. While I had 2 seconds to get ready after pressing the button and adjusting my shoulders, I had to quickly look at the mirror, to see if my mouth was centered enough in the magnifying glass. 8. I had to make sure nothing 'unexpected' popped out of my corset. 9. My lips were going numb from holding their position. 10. My hands have somewhat of a weak grip, and I couldn't hold onto the magnifying glass for too long. Overall... This was an incredibly difficult shot. More difficult than Transcendentality.
